Contao-Camp 2024
Ergebnis 1 bis 15 von 15

Thema: Navigation wird nicht mehr angezeigt.

  1. #1
    Contao-Nutzer
    Registriert seit
    09.11.2018.
    Beiträge
    20

    Standard Navigation wird nicht mehr angezeigt.

    Hallo,
    ich hoffe ihr könnt mir nochmals helfen.
    Auf unserer Internetseite ist auf einmal die Navigation weg.
    Mobil ist die noch da, aber nicht mehr wenn ich über den PC
    auf die Seite gehe.
    Ich habe überhaupt gar nichts an der Internetseite gemacht, deswegen
    ist mir das wieder mal unerklärlich :-/

    Es ist auch auf einmal nach unten viel mehr Platz als es vorher war.

    Würde mich sehr freuen wenn mir jemand helfen könnte.

    https://holzkaiserkoeln.de

  2. #2
    Contao-Nutzer
    Registriert seit
    09.11.2018.
    Beiträge
    20

    Standard

    Ich sehe gerade, dass die Seite normal angezeigt wird wenn ich über Firefox drauf gehe.
    Aber bei Chrome funktioniert es nicht.

  3. #3
    Community-Moderator
    Wandelndes Contao-Lexikon
    Avatar von Spooky
    Registriert seit
    12.04.2012.
    Ort
    Scotland
    Beiträge
    33.896
    Partner-ID
    10107

    Standard

    Mir fällt auf der Seite jetzt nichts auf, siehe Screenshot im Anhang.

    Unabhängig davon: du solltest URLs umschreiben in den System Einstellungen aktivieren - und deine Startseite sollte den Alias index haben.

  4. #4
    Community-Moderator
    Wandelndes Contao-Lexikon
    Avatar von Spooky
    Registriert seit
    12.04.2012.
    Ort
    Scotland
    Beiträge
    33.896
    Partner-ID
    10107

    Standard

    Zitat Zitat von HolzKaiser Beitrag anzeigen
    Ich sehe gerade, dass die Seite normal angezeigt wird wenn ich über Firefox drauf gehe.
    Aber bei Chrome funktioniert es nicht.
    Du verwendest in deinem eigenen CSS folgendes:
    Code:
    #main {
        padding-right: 10px;
        padding-left: 10px;
    }
    Das zerstört das Holy-Grail-Layout. Du brauchst noch zusätzlich
    Code:
    #main {
        box-sizing: border-box;
    }

  5. #5
    Contao-Nutzer
    Registriert seit
    09.11.2018.
    Beiträge
    20

    Standard

    Zitat Zitat von Spooky Beitrag anzeigen
    Du verwendest in deinem eigenen CSS folgendes:
    Code:
    #main {
        padding-right: 10px;
        padding-left: 10px;
    }
    Das zerstört das Holy-Grail-Layout. Du brauchst noch zusätzlich
    Code:
    #main {
        box-sizing: border-box;
    }
    Ok vielen Dank. Schaue ich mir sofort an.
    Komisch nur das es bis jetzt die ganze Zeit funktioniert hat :-/

  6. #6
    Contao-Nutzer
    Registriert seit
    09.11.2018.
    Beiträge
    20

    Standard

    Habe ich geändert, es ändert sich aber nichts.
    Navigation wird weiterhin über Chrome nicht angezeigt.

  7. #7
    Wandelndes Contao-Lexikon Avatar von tab
    Registriert seit
    22.10.2013.
    Beiträge
    10.060
    Contao-Projekt unterstützen

    Support Contao

    Standard

    Eigentlich hätte das nie funktionieren sollen. Da haben die Browser wohl großzügigerweise korrigiert. Im Firefox funtioniert es immer noch, in Google Chrome halt nicht.

  8. #8
    Contao-Nutzer
    Registriert seit
    09.11.2018.
    Beiträge
    20

    Standard

    Zitat Zitat von tab Beitrag anzeigen
    Eigentlich hätte das nie funktionieren sollen. Da haben die Browser wohl großzügigerweise korrigiert. Im Firefox funtioniert es immer noch, in Google Chrome halt nicht.
    Wie meinst du das? Was habe ich falsch gemacht?

  9. #9
    Wandelndes Contao-Lexikon Avatar von tab
    Registriert seit
    22.10.2013.
    Beiträge
    10.060
    Contao-Projekt unterstützen

    Support Contao

    Standard

    Wenn du an #main padding, border oder margin setzt, wird diese Box breiter und deine linke Spalte #left passt da nicht mehr daneben. Abhilfe entweder wie von Spooky geschrieben. Das funktioniert auch, aber deine Änderung wird im Frontend nicht ausgegeben. Mach mal eine Systemwartung, zumindest Seitencache löschen und CSS neu generieren lassen oder einfach komplett. Danach sollte es sichtbar werden.
    Alternativ, so war es ursprünglich vorgesehen, die Paddings etc dem #main .inside setzen anstatt #main. Dazu ist das div .inside da. Gleiches gilt auch für die anderen Spalten (#left, #right).

  10. #10
    Contao-Nutzer
    Registriert seit
    09.11.2018.
    Beiträge
    20

    Standard

    Zitat Zitat von tab Beitrag anzeigen
    Wenn du an #main padding, border oder margin setzt, wird diese Box breiter und deine linke Spalte #left passt da nicht mehr daneben. Abhilfe entweder wie von Spooky geschrieben. Das funktioniert auch, aber deine Änderung wird im Frontend nicht ausgegeben. Mach mal eine Systemwartung, zumindest Seitencache löschen und CSS neu generieren lassen oder einfach komplett. Danach sollte es sichtbar werden.
    Alternativ, so war es ursprünglich vorgesehen, die Paddings etc dem #main .inside setzen anstatt #main. Dazu ist das div .inside da. Gleiches gilt auch für die anderen Spalten (#left, #right).
    Ok, ich bekomme das nicht hin. Bin wahrscheinlich zu blöd dafür. Das funktioniert nicht :-/

  11. #11
    Contao-Nutzer Avatar von mopic
    Registriert seit
    15.01.2018.
    Ort
    An der Ostsee
    Beiträge
    46

    Standard

    Hast du das wirklich richtig umgesetzt, also was Spooky geschrieben hat? Denn dann geht es auch.

    ...also anstelle von deinem CSS in "bildschirm.css"
    Code:
    #main {
        padding-right: 10px;
        padding-left: 10px;
        padding-bottom: 10px;
        line-height: 1.7;
        min-height: 200px;
    }
    ...füge bitte die Zeile "box-sizing: border-box;" zusätzlich ein.

    Code:
    #main {
        padding-right: 10px;
        padding-left: 10px;
        padding-bottom: 10px;
        line-height: 1.7;
        min-height: 200px;
        box-sizing: border-box;
    }
    Ich habe es gerade ausprobiert.

  12. #12
    Contao-Nutzer
    Registriert seit
    09.11.2018.
    Beiträge
    20

    Standard

    Zitat Zitat von mopic Beitrag anzeigen
    Hast du das wirklich richtig umgesetzt, also was Spooky geschrieben hat? Denn dann geht es auch.

    ...also anstelle von deinem CSS in "bildschirm.css"
    Code:
    #main {
        padding-right: 10px;
        padding-left: 10px;
        padding-bottom: 10px;
        line-height: 1.7;
        min-height: 200px;
    }
    ...füge bitte die Zeile "box-sizing: border-box;" zusätzlich ein.

    Code:
    #main {
        padding-right: 10px;
        padding-left: 10px;
        padding-bottom: 10px;
        line-height: 1.7;
        min-height: 200px;
        box-sizing: border-box;
    }
    Ich habe es gerade ausprobiert.

    Es ändert sich rein gar nichts. Ich verzweifel hier :-/

  13. #13
    Community-Moderator
    Wandelndes Contao-Lexikon
    Avatar von Spooky
    Registriert seit
    12.04.2012.
    Ort
    Scotland
    Beiträge
    33.896
    Partner-ID
    10107

    Standard

    Du hast die CSS Änderung noch nicht eingefügt. Zumindest ist davon nichts zu sehen.

  14. #14
    Contao-Nutzer
    Registriert seit
    09.11.2018.
    Beiträge
    20

    Standard

    Zitat Zitat von Spooky Beitrag anzeigen
    Du hast die CSS Änderung noch nicht eingefügt. Zumindest ist davon nichts zu sehen.
    Ich habe das in der bildschirm.css Datei geändert und die über Filezilla wieder hochgeladen?!

  15. #15
    Contao-Nutzer
    Registriert seit
    09.11.2018.
    Beiträge
    20

    Standard

    OK ich glaube jetzt hat es funktioniert :-D

    Tausend Dank!!! Ich probiere mal noch weiter ob das jetzt alles wieder richtig ist!

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)

Lesezeichen

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•